Orangeburg Co. deputy honored with procession after 75-day COVID battle

Orangeburg Co. deputy honored with procession after 75-day COVID battle Orangeburg’s County Sheriff’s Deputy Lieutenant Dexter Ladson honored with procession after 75-day COVID battle (Source: Family photo) By Emily Scarlett | February 7, 2021 at 4:02 PM EST - Updated February 8 at 7:45 AM ORANGEBURG COUNTY, S.C. (WIS) - A deputy with the Orangeburg County Sheriff’s Office spent about 75 days in the hospital after testing positive for COVID-19. As he returned home this weekend, his family and the sheriff’s office wanted to be sure he knew just how much he was missed. A celebratory procession was all in honor of Deputy Lieutenant Dexter Ladson as he made it back home after more than two months in the hospital.
